On 12.07.19 12:46, Stefano Garzarella wrote:
> When the backing_file is specified as a JSON object, the
> qemu_gluster_reopen_prepare() fails with this message:
>     invalid URI json:{"server.0.host": ...}
> 
> In this case, we should call qemu_gluster_init() using the QDict
> 'state->options' that contains the parameters already parsed.
> 
> Buglink: https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=1542445
> Signed-off-by: Stefano Garzarella <address@hidden>
> ---
>  block/gluster.c | 11 ++++++++++-
>  1 file changed, 10 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
> 
> diff --git a/block/gluster.c b/block/gluster.c
> index 62f8ff2147..26971db1ea 100644
> --- a/block/gluster.c
> +++ b/block/gluster.c
> @@ -931,7 +931,16 @@ static int qemu_gluster_reopen_prepare(BDRVReopenState 
> *state,
>      gconf->has_debug = true;
>      gconf->logfile = g_strdup(s->logfile);
>      gconf->has_logfile = true;
> -    reop_s->glfs = qemu_gluster_init(gconf, state->bs->filename, NULL, errp);
> +    /*
> +     * If 'bs->filename' starts with "json:", then 'state->options' will
> +     * contain the parameters already parsed.
> +     */
> +    if (state->bs->filename && !strstart(state->bs->filename, "json:", 
> NULL)) {
> +        reop_s->glfs = qemu_gluster_init(gconf, state->bs->filename, NULL,
> +                                         errp);
> +    } else {
> +        reop_s->glfs = qemu_gluster_init(gconf, NULL, state->options, errp);
> +    }

Hmmm, aren’t they always in state->options?
